I'm riding 200 miles raising money for the MS Society. The route is in the shape of the letters MS, clockwise, starting and finishing in St Andrews.

I have a close family connection to MS and after riding a similar route (anticlockwise) last year I want to do it again and raise a few pounds to help towards fighting this disease. Funds raised will go towards the MS Society Scotland - Fife Group and distributed to all functions of the MS Society from there.

Please join me! I'm starting out in St Andrews at around 5am, with stops roughly every 3 hours in Pitscottie 8am, Milnathort 12noon and Abernethy 4pm returning to St Andrews hopefully around 8pm. This year I've also put together a 90 mile "M" route starting from Newburgh meeting the 200 route for the lunch stop at Milnathort and/or afternoon stop in Abernethy.
